WAYCROSS, GA (January 29, 2014) - Officials of the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series are excited to head to the sunshine state of Florida again this year for its second stop of the 2014 season. The stars of the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series will travel to East Bay Raceway Park in Tampa, Florida for the 38th Annual Winternationals at the famed "Clay by the Bay" for a week of action-packed events in early February.

Officials of East Bay Raceway park have been steady working on the facilities and the track itself in preparations for this years events. New clay has been added to the racing surface combined with a racer friendly tire rule put in place by the LOLMDS, fans are sure to see some thrilling racing all week long. The Winternationals, held at East Bay Raceway Park in Tampa, FL will consist of an open practice on Sunday, February 9th, from 6PM to 9PM and six full nights of racing, from February 10th through 15th. Each day, the Drivers Meeting will be at 5:15PM (ET), Hot Laps will begin at 6:00PM, and racing will begin at 7:00PM.

The Winternationals will offer racers over $200,000 in purse money over the six nights of events. Two additional starting positions will also be added to each night's feature event, giving 26 drivers a chance to earn a coveted Winternationals feature win. The 25th starting position will go to the driver that fails to transfer into the feature event through the heat races or B-mains and who was the fastest in qualifying among those drivers. The 26th starting position will go to the winner of the DirtonDirt.com Strawberry Dash each night.

East Bay Raceway Park officials have added two Non-Qualifier Races to the schedule of events for Friday and Saturday Feb 14th and 15th. Racers that fail to transfer to the feature event on those nights will compete in a Non-Qualifiers race that will pay $500 to the winner and $100 to start for each of those two nights.

History will be made on Thursday, February 13, 2014 at East Bay Raceway Park when the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series will air LIVE on the MAVTV Network at 9:30 PM EST. The 38th Annual Winternationals at EBRP has a long tradition of producing some exciting finishes on the extremely racy ¼ mile bull ring. This monumental event for the LOLMDS is sure to draw a huge television audience from around the country. MAVTV has signed renowned motor racing broadcaster, Dave Despain to host the LIVE event. Lucas Oil Production Studios will film Friday and Saturday's events at EBRP for a tape-delayed broadcast on the MAVTV American Real Network, later this year.
